FIBA World Cup history: Basketball enters a football stadium in Qatar

Al Janoub Stadium has been transformed into an 8,200-seat basketball arena and will host Qatar against China in the Asian Qualifiers

A FIBA Basketball World Cup game will be played inside a football stadium for the first time in the competition’s history. The landmark event will take place in 2027 at Al Janoub Stadium, one of the venues used for the 2022 FIFA World Cup in Qatar.

A first dress rehearsal is scheduled for Thursday, August 27, when Qatar host China at 6:00 pm CET to open the Second Round of the Asian Qualifiers. Designed by Zaha Hadid and inaugurated in 2019, the stadium has been converted into an enclosed basketball venue with a capacity of 8,200.

Al Janoub Stadium will be one of four venues used for the 2027 FIBA Basketball World Cup, alongside Al Attiyah Arena, Duhail Arena and Lusail Multi-Purpose Hall. The Qatar-China qualifier will offer an early look at the experience awaiting teams and fans in Doha next year.
